Shuttle / ride up road to the top. Road is suitable for regular cars and there is a parking lot with room for about 12 cars.
NOTE: The gate for cars opens at 8am (ish, sometimes a few minutes late) and closes at sundown. Don't get stuck and get locked in the evening
